Strategic Plant Positioning



Think about the format of your garden and the sorts of plants you have to tactically put them for optimum pest-proofing effectiveness.

Beginning by organizing plants with similar resistance to bugs together. By doing this, you can create an all-natural obstacle that prevents pests from spreading throughout your garden.



Furthermore, positioning pest-repelling plants like marigolds, lavender, or mint near more at risk plants can help shield them. Tall plants, such as sunflowers or corn, can work as a shield for much shorter plants versus insects like rabbits or ground-dwelling pests.

Remember to leave enough room between plants to improve air blood circulation and reduce the threat of illness that pests may carry.

In addition, take into consideration planting strong-smelling herbs like rosemary or basil near at risk plants to perplex insects' senses and make it harder for them to situate their targets.

Effective Bug Control Approaches



For combating garden bugs effectively, carrying out a multi-faceted insect control approach is essential. Beginning by encouraging natural predators like birds, ladybugs, and praying mantises to aid maintain bug populaces in check. In addition, exercising excellent yard hygiene by removing particles and weeds where parasites could conceal can make your garden much less congenial to unwanted site visitors.

Think about utilizing physical obstacles such as row cover materials or netting to protect susceptible plants from bugs like caterpillars and birds. Applying natural chemicals like neem oil or insecticidal soap can likewise work versus certain insects while being much less damaging to helpful pests and the environment. It's essential to revolve your plants each period to avoid the buildup of parasite populations that target certain plants.

Frequently examine your plants for indications of pest damages so you can act without delay. By incorporating these methods and remaining watchful, you can successfully control yard insects and enjoy a growing, pest-free yard.
